  • Abstract
    The emission of toxic gas, sulfur oxides and nitrogen oxides has become serious issue in the world. A review of EB method to remove the SOx and NOx in flue gas from coal-fired power plants was described in this paper. A design of an electron curtain accelerator of 600 keV was given, and a facility for purification of flue gas from coal combustion power plant of 10 MW was described here
